Cypress Point Lookout is one of the most picturesque stops along the famed 17-Mile Drive, a scenic route celebrated for its breathtaking views of the Pacific coastline and lush landscapes. Nestled within the beautiful Pebble Beach area of Monterey, California, this lookout offers visitors an unparalleled vantage point to observe the dramatic shoreline, rugged cliffs, and the iconic cypress trees that dot the landscape. The lookout is particularly famous for its stunning sunsets, making it a favored spot for photographers and nature lovers alike. The fresh ocean breeze and the sound of crashing waves create a tranquil atmosphere that invites visitors to pause and soak in the beauty of this coastal paradise. As you stand at Cypress Point Lookout, prepare to be captivated by the panoramic views that stretch across the ocean and the rolling hills. The area is also rich in wildlife, so keep an eye out for sea otters, seals, and various bird species that call this region home. Local tips
- Visit during sunset for the most spectacular views and photo opportunities.
- Bring binoculars to spot wildlife, including sea otters and various bird species.
- Wear comfortable shoes for a pleasant walk along the viewing paths.
- Check the weather forecast; clear days offer the best visibility and views.
- Consider visiting early in the morning to avoid crowds and enjoy a peaceful experience.
